What is the diff between the serato dj intro 1.0.0 and the 1.0.5????? please tell me you can trigger the samples from the controller, or at lease the keys from the laptop like the SL.
Serato, Forum Moderator
Mathew C 9:29 PM - 15 January, 2012
1.0.0-1.0.5 the VCI-400 and the Pioneer DDJ ERGO-V were added as controllers.

Features in Serato DJ Intro 1.0.5:
Serato Sync locks tracks together for seamless grooves
Serato Crates make audio file management easy.
Advanced iTunes integration
Cue points allow you to quickly access specific parts of songs
Loops repeat selected sections
DJ-FX will enhance any DJ set, delay, filter and reverb, three FX chainable for each deck
Sample Player can play up to four short samples, audio loops, sound effects or full length tracks in addition to the two tracks you’re mixing

Samuel S 11:15 PM - 16 January, 2012
I would also like to note that the feature set of Serato DJ Intro is essentially locked as it stands. While there may be some improvements in future, features such as sample player control and keyboard shortcuts are advanced features only available for ITCH and Scratch Live.
